Cara menggunakan fungsi pusat membeli-belah pembangun PHP: Cipta halaman butiran produk
Dengan perkembangan pesat e-dagang, membangunkan tapak web pusat membeli-belah berfungsi sepenuhnya telah menjadi keperluan bagi ramai pembangun. Sebagai salah satu halaman terpenting dalam laman web pusat membeli-belah, halaman butiran produk perlu memaparkan maklumat terperinci tentang produk, menarik perhatian pengguna dan menggesa mereka untuk membeli. Artikel ini akan memperkenalkan cara menggunakan halaman butiran produk dalam fungsi bandar pembangun PHP dan memberikan contoh kod.
Langkah 1: Buat jadual pangkalan data
Pertama, kita perlu mencipta jadual pangkalan data untuk menyimpan butiran produk. Katakan pangkalan data kami dinamakan "myshop" dan jadual dinamakan "produk". Jadual mengandungi medan berikut: id (ID produk), nama (nama produk), harga (harga produk), penerangan (penerangan produk). Jadual boleh dibuat menggunakan pernyataan SQL berikut:
CREATE TABLE products ( id INT(11) NOT NULL AUTO_INCREMENT, name VARCHAR(100) NOT NULL, price DECIMAL(10, 2) NOT NULL, description TEXT, PRIMARY KEY (id) );
Langkah 2: Buat templat HTML untuk halaman butiran produk
Sebelum mencipta halaman butiran produk, kami mula-mula mencipta templat HTML sebagai asas. Berikut ialah contoh templat HTML halaman butiran produk ringkas:
<!DOCTYPE html> <html> <head> <title>产品详情</title> </head> <body> <h1>产品详情</h1> <div> <h2 id="product-name"></h2> <p id="product-price"></p> <p id="product-description"></p> </div> </body> </html>
Langkah 3: Tulis kod PHP untuk mendapatkan maklumat produk
Seterusnya, kita perlu menulis kod PHP untuk mendapatkan maklumat produk daripada pangkalan data dan masukkannya ke bahagian tengah templat HTML . Berikut ialah contoh kod PHP mudah:
<?php // 建立与数据库的连接 $conn = mysqli_connect("localhost", "username", "password", "myshop"); if (!$conn) { die("连接数据库失败: " . mysqli_connect_error()); } // 获取产品ID $productId = $_GET["id"]; // 查询产品信息 $sql = "SELECT * FROM products WHERE id = $productId"; $result = mysqli_query($conn, $sql); $product = mysqli_fetch_assoc($result); // 关闭数据库连接 mysqli_close($conn); ?> <!-- 在HTML模板中插入产品信息 --> <script> window.onload = function() { document.getElementById("product-name").innerHTML = "<?php echo $product['name']; ?>"; document.getElementById("product-price").innerHTML = "价格: <?php echo $product['price']; ?>"; document.getElementById("product-description").innerHTML = "<?php echo $product['description']; ?>"; }; </script>
Dalam kod di atas, kami mula-mula mewujudkan sambungan ke pangkalan data dan kemudian mendapatkan ID produk (biasanya melalui parameter URL). Seterusnya, laksanakan pernyataan pertanyaan untuk mendapatkan maklumat produk dan simpan keputusan dalam pembolehubah $product. Akhir sekali, tutup sambungan pangkalan data. Dalam templat HTML, kami menggunakan pernyataan echo
PHP untuk memasukkan maklumat produk secara dinamik ke dalam elemen HTML yang sepadan.
Langkah 4: Uji halaman butiran produk
Selepas melengkapkan langkah di atas, kita boleh mengakses halaman butiran produk melalui URL berikut:
http://yourdomain.com/product.php?id=1
Antaranya, id=1 mewakili ID produk. Dengan mengubah suai nilai parameter id, kami boleh melihat butiran produk yang berbeza.
Ringkasan:
Melalui langkah di atas, kami berjaya mencipta halaman butiran produk berasaskan PHP. Dalam pembangunan sebenar, kami boleh mengembangkan halaman ini mengikut keperluan, seperti menambah gambar produk, ulasan pengguna dan fungsi lain. Saya harap artikel ini akan membantu anda memahami cara menggunakan halaman butiran produk fungsi PHP Developer City. Ingat, pembelajaran dan amalan berterusan adalah cara terbaik untuk meningkatkan kemahiran pembangunan anda. Perkembangan yang menggembirakan!
Atas ialah kandungan terperinci Cara menggunakan fungsi bandar pembangun PHP: Buat halaman butiran produk.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!